The most crucial step to creating a flawless makeup look starts well before you open your makeup bag. Skin prep is like the canvas for your art – a well-prepared skin surface makes it easier to apply makeup and the products will look better on your skin. Start by cleaning your face with a mild cleanser to remove any dirt or oil. This is especially important if you have oily or acne-prone skin. After cleansing, lightly exfoliate to remove any dead skin cells. This helps your makeup apply more evenly.
Product | Skin Type |
---|---|
Cleanser | All Types |
Exfoliator | Normal to Oily |
Next, apply a hydrating toner to balance your pH levels and prep your skin for moisturizer. Follow this up with a layer of hydrating moisturizer, to soften and plump up your skin. If you have dry skin, consider using a hydrating serum before the moisturizer. Lastly, never skip sunscreen if you are stepping out during the day.
- Hyrdrating Toner: Suits all skin types, especially dry and mature skin.
- Moisturizer: A must for all skin types.
- Hydrating Serum: Best for dry and mature skin.
- Sunscreen: Non-negotiable for all skin types and ages.
Grabbing the right skin care products for your skin type is vital to achieve an impeccable makeup look. Always remember, great makeup begins with great skin.
Every one of us dreams to have that soul epic gaze. However, it requires some specific techniques to enhance your eyes using makeup. An important step is considering your eye shape. Whether you have monolids, hooded eyes, or deep-set eyes, there are numerous makeup hacks you can use to make your eyes pop. For instance, eye shadow placement can either lift or lower the point of your gaze.
Eye Shape | Makeup Technique |
---|---|
Monolid | Graduated Eye Shadow |
Hooded Eyes | Matte Eye Shadow |
Deep Set Eyes | Highlighting the Inner Corners |
Never underestimate the power of a suitable eye liner or kohl. It can give depth to your eyes, make them look bigger or smaller depending on the technique used. Mascara is another significant product for your eyes. The right application can lift and accentuate your lashes, giving you a fresh and awake look. Always ensure to use a primer before applying shadow which helps to keep your eye makeup intact all day long.
- Eye Liner/Kohl: For framing and defining your eyes.
- Mascara: For a brighter, more alert look.
- Primer: To prolong the wear of your eye shadow.
These techniques, when applied accurately, can make your eyes look more fascinating and captivating.
